  • The aim of this research is to assess the effects of organo-modified reservoir sludge (OMRS) on the properties of RPMs by replacing a portion of the total cement content with OMRS particles. Correspondingly, compressive strengths and permeability ratios of the reactive powder concrete (RPC) with various percentages of organo-modified reservoir sludge were measured and compared to that of plain RPC. The flow value, apparent porosity, water absorption, apparent specific gravity and bulk density were measured to further understand the effect of OMRS on the properties of the RPCs. Plain reactive powder mortar with a flow value of 135% and compressive strength of 77MPa was used as a baseline to compare the results of different tests performed on the RPMs containing various percentages of OMRS.
